Hannah Bonecutter, actress, writer, producer and Chicago native to release her groundbreaking independent film!

The star of multi-talented entrepreneur Hannah Bonecutter continues to
rise with the release of her highly anticipated independent film, Minstrel vs. Puppet.

"MVP" as it's known in the cinematic community has already garnered critical acclaim and award consideration. According to Bonecutter, "There are certain avenues of the film industry that neglect to tell the compelling stories of women and minorities. I think our team did a fantastic job of sharing a story that's not only captivating, but will foster long overdue dialogue."

In short, Minstrel vs. Puppet creatively explores the internal conflict many women, particularly women of color, experience as they juggle the complicated aspects of beauty, intelligence, and social acceptance.
From the viewpoint of two different women, MVP skillfully illustrates how this internal conflict can manifest externally.

Bonecutter adds, "I wanted to create a film that addresses the myriad of social factors that influence the way women see and characterize themselves. Today, women are business owners, governmental leaders, and much more. As a result, the way we view ourselves now is infinitely
more complex than when our only options were a maid or housewife."

A staple in the Chicago community, Hannah Bonecutter has created a film that has been shown in more than 20 film festivals around the world, including Germany, Amsterdam, Canada, the United States, and even France at the renowned Cannes Film Festival.

Minstrel vs. Puppet has won several judges awards, including the Outstanding U.S.Narrative Award at the D.C. Shorts Film Festival, as well as the Award of Merit from the Best Shorts Competition.
